Minimum Budgies Cage Requirnments

In the first place Things First 

Your budgie is characteristically gymnastic and fun loving, hence he's going to need a great deal of space to jump from roost to roost, swing, bonk his toys and fly a bit. For the roosts, you'll require truly a couple to keep your companion entertained. A couple of roosts ought to be set up in a stepping stool sort way so your winged creature can climb or jump from roost to roost. Different roosts ought to be set close toys so your winged animal can play. Your pen needs to be enormous enough that these toys, roosts and nourishment dishes are divided far enough separated that your feathered companion can at present do everything without crapping everywhere on his assets.


Making sense of It 

Your budgie's pen needs to be extensive enough that your little gentleman can spread his wings out totally without hitting the sides of the pen, toys or roosts. This is without a doubt the base width and length. On the off chance that you have more than one budgie in the confine, you'll have to verify each one winged creature can do this without hitting toys, roosts, the dividers of the pen or one another.


Essentials 

The standard least pen size suggested by fledgling experts is 12- by 18- by 18-inches for a solitary fowl. This confine size is fine if your budgie is outside of the enclosure more often than not, however in the event that you have a pen limited budgie, it will be much excessively little to keep your feathered creature glad and sound. For two budgies, 39- by 20- by 32-inches is a suggested size. The bars of the confine ought to be flat and divided close to 1/2-inch separated. More extensive than this and your little fellow could get adhered attempting to escape!




Contemplations 

As a rule, you ought to purchase the greatest, most secure pen you can manage. Budgies need both vertical tallness and width for bouncing and flying. Don't run with the first confine you see at the pet store, regardless of the possibility that it expresses its "beginning and end your parakeet needs." Unfortunately, huge numbers of these pens are much excessively little to house your fledgling and all that it needs to be upbeat and solid.

Beautiful Golden Pheasant


Ring-necked Pheasants stride across open fields and weedy roadsides in the U.S. and southern Canada. Males sport iridescent copper-and-gold plumage, a red face, and a crisp white collar; their rooster-like crowing can be heard from up to a mile away. The brown females blend in with their field habitat. Introduced to the U.S. from Asia in the 1880s, pheasants quickly became one of North America’s most popular upland game birds. Watch for them along roads or bursting into flight from brushy cover.

Rainbow Lorikeets

Introduction

Lories and lorikeets live in huge runs in nature. Contingent upon the species, lories and lorikeets start from the southeast Asia archipelago or parts of Australia. These winged animals will fly from island to island looking for sustenance. Lories and lorikeets will consume coconuts and grapes and they are viewed as an irritation to agriculturists. The itinerant Rainbow lorikeet takes after eucalyptus blossoms blossoming along the Australian coast. The International Union for Conservation of Nature (IUCN) records the preservation status of most lories and lorikeets as "minimum concern", albeit a few species are viewed as helpless or "close debilitated". The Red-and-blue lory (Eos histrio), Rimitara lorikeet (Vini kuhlii), and Ultramarine lorikeet (Vini ultramarina) are jeopardized.




Species

There are 12 genera of lories and lorikeets with 56 species and various subspecies. The most well-known pet species is the red lory.

Physical Description

Lorikeets have a more drawn out, more thin tail and are littler contrasted with the short, limit tail of the bigger lories. 

Plumage color fluctuates with the species and reaches from red, blue, yellow, green, violet, and olive tan. 

The famous rainbow lory has a yellow neckline with blue crown, cheeks and brow and also a red midsection banished with dark and thighs yellow banned with green. 

Most pet lory and lorikeet species are sexually monomorphic, however sexual dimorphism is perceived in a few animal categories. Case in point, the female pixie lorikeet (Charmosyna pulchella) has yellow fixes on the sides of her rear end, while the underside of the tail can be splendid yellow in the male.

Diet

Lories and lorikeets are nectarivores that eat  nectar, blooms, delicate soil grown foods, and bugs. This eating regimen makes watery droppings bringing about a significant improvement suited for aviary life. 

Partner lories and lorikeets must be furnished with sufficient water. Change sustenance frequently to avoid waste. 

Coarseness is redundant however lories and lorikeets will consume coarseness when it is given. Actually, a few people will indulge coarseness when sick putting them at danger for impaction.


Behaviour

Lories and lorikeets are savvy and very lively. They can learn words and traps effectively. 

They can be more qualified as enthusiastic aviary fledglings, notwithstanding they are regional and don't coexist with other fowl species. 

Rainbow lories may think about their backs. 

Rummaging is an essential piece of ordinary day by day parrot movement. Show and urge pet fledglings to play and search.
